Adjective

1.
personalitymentally stable and sensible
  • Her grounded demeanor helps her handle stressful situations well..
sensible stable
2.
aviationTECH.not allowed to flyTECH.
  • The plane was grounded due to bad weather.
earthbound landed
3.
electricityTECH.connected to earth in electricityTECH.
  • The grounded wire ensures safety.
earthed
4.
disciplineRareconfined indoors as punishmentRare
  • She was grounded for breaking the rules.
confined detained restricted
5.
maritimeTECH.aground, unable to moveTECH.
  • The ship was grounded on the sandbank.
beached stranded
